Article clipped from Covington Friend

Mrs. George Allen, who resided on Prairie Creek in Fulton town ship, died the first of the week as a result of childbirth. A child was born to her three weeks ago, and she had been dismissed by her physician. Complications set in, however, and death resulted. She was 28 years of age, and her mai den name was Jackson. Her moth er died while she was a baby, and she was raised by Riley Richard son. She was the mother of five children. The funeral services were conducted Wednesday after noon at Cooper Chapel, with inter ment in the Cooper cemetery.
